diff options
author | Vincent Blut <vincent.debian@free.fr> | 2018-03-15 12:42:27 +0100 |
---|---|---|
committer | Vincent Blut <vincent.debian@free.fr> | 2018-03-15 12:42:27 +0100 |
commit | 164712c8ac6154d9d5b39ccc7cf151b97742903b (patch) | |
tree | 7dde6985ca6b6124745fa5c2b067467ae3cf6dc9 /ntp_signd.c | |
parent | 3f9054c74b7de46c754ffe179dd357371de64c6f (diff) |
New upstream version 3.3-pre1
Diffstat (limited to 'ntp_signd.c')
-rw-r--r-- | ntp_signd.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/ntp_signd.c b/ntp_signd.c index 0d88d7b..6328b61 100644 --- a/ntp_signd.c +++ b/ntp_signd.c @@ -235,7 +235,7 @@ read_write_socket(int sock_fd, int event, void *anything) return; /* Disable output and wait for a response */ - SCH_SetFileHandlerEvents(sock_fd, SCH_FILE_INPUT); + SCH_SetFileHandlerEvent(sock_fd, SCH_FILE_OUTPUT, 0); } if (event == SCH_FILE_INPUT) { @@ -283,7 +283,7 @@ read_write_socket(int sock_fd, int event, void *anything) /* Move the head and enable output for the next packet */ queue_head = NEXT_QUEUE_INDEX(queue_head); if (!IS_QUEUE_EMPTY()) - SCH_SetFileHandlerEvents(sock_fd, SCH_FILE_INPUT | SCH_FILE_OUTPUT); + SCH_SetFileHandlerEvent(sock_fd, SCH_FILE_OUTPUT, 1); } } @@ -369,7 +369,7 @@ NSD_SignAndSendPacket(uint32_t key_id, NTP_Packet *packet, NTP_Remote_Address *r /* Enable output if there was no pending request */ if (IS_QUEUE_EMPTY()) - SCH_SetFileHandlerEvents(sock_fd, SCH_FILE_INPUT | SCH_FILE_OUTPUT); + SCH_SetFileHandlerEvent(sock_fd, SCH_FILE_OUTPUT, 1); queue_tail = NEXT_QUEUE_INDEX(queue_tail); |